Fans can rest easy knowing that the sequel is in highly capable hands. Jared Bush, who co-directed and co-wrote the original film (and went on to direct the mega-hit Encanto ), returns as the primary writer and director for Zootopia 2 .

The original Zootopia was lauded for its sophisticated commentary on prejudice and racial profiling, and the sequel doubles down on these ideas by exploring them on a broader, systemic level. Critical analysis of the film notes that while the first movie examined individual biases, showing how prejudice can be literally baked into the architecture and laws of a society, as reptiles are an excluded and vilified group.
